If you're not going to do any gaming or video editing, AMD X2 processors are still more cost-effective than Intel C2D procys. And an E2160 is NOT Core 2 Duo. It is an 'ordinary' dual core, and is easily outperformed by an AMD processor in the same price class.
For example, an AMD X2 4000+ or 4400+ is faster than an E2160 in most applications, and costs much less than the cheapest Core 2 Duo, the E4300.
Even the 4000+ is more than fast enough for your intended use. Pair it with a motherboard based on a good chipset with reasonable onboard graphics, e.g., a Gigabyte GA-M68SM-S2, and you have an adequate mobo-CPU pair for slightly more than the cost of the cheapest C2D processor alone.
